Inpatient Drug Rehab in Harrisburg, North Carolina

Inpatient drug rehab in Harrisburg is a very effective treatment option for individuals who are drug and alcohol addicted. Long-term success rates show that outpatient treatment is not going to suffice for those experiencing substance abuse problems in Harrisburg, North Carolina which require a more intense and exclusive rehabilitation option. This is primarily because of the fact that outpatienttreatment leaves the doorway wide open for setbacks because of easy accessibility to drugs and alcohol, along with the fact there are environmental factors which trigger drug abuse which can be left unhandled. This leaves addicts incredibly vulnerable and even if a person manages to detox from drugs or alcohol, this hardly ever remains so within an outpatient center in the Harrisburg, NC. area. Likewise, inpatient drug rehab in Harrisburg makes sure the individual has no access to alcohol or drugs when they're still experiencing intense cravings to use. Moreover, it offers the correct setting for advancement and rehabilitation due to the fact all things in their environment is going to be proactive and contribute to healing rather than setbacks and disappointments.

Inpatient drug rehab in Harrisburg, North Carolina is offered in long and short term options, however the most proven choice as can be seen in long-term results in a long-term inpatient drug rehab in Harrisburg, NC. which offers rehabilitation for 90-120 days. This is the gold standard because individuals have enough time to physically stabilize but most importantly address all the issues in their lives that could trigger a relapse if left unresolved.
